Super Lawyers selects attorneys using a patented multi-phase selection process. Peer nominations and evaluations are combined with independent research. Each candidate is evaluated on 12 indicators of peer recognition and professional achievement. Selections are made on an annual, state-by-state basis. The objective is to create a credible, comprehensive and diverse listing of outstanding attorneys that can be used as a resource for attorneys and consumers searching for legal counsel. A representative number of attorneys from small, medium and large firms are selected and only 5% of attorneys are selected to a state Super Lawyer List. Attorneys who are 40 years of age or younger or who have been in practice ten years or less are eligible for a state’s Rising Stars List. Only 2.5% of attorneys are selected to this list.
